  10. Right now about 56-58 teams make the post season. Any playoff beyond 4 teams will significantly reduce the # of bowl games and # of teams playing in the post season. Forget New Years Day with a full slate of games. That would suck! I think part of the reward for teams and fans are all the bowl game festivities that go on the week of the game. Those go away for the teams in the playoff. Really all that is needed is to rotate among the BCS bowls 2 games and then add a championship game. Seed the top 4 and the winners play each other. This will at least keep the bowl traditions alive. Some of the bowls have a tough enough time getting tickets sold and tv viewers to watch. Adding playoff games every week would be the kiss of death to the bowl games. This would affect USF in a negative way. You think their would still be a bowl game for the 3rd place finisher in the Big East? Think again. If we finished 3rd we would be sitting at home ******** about the playoff system that ruined the bowl system.
